test: drop the cwd-relative sys.path.insert calls from the test suite (#37802)
* test: drop the cwd-relative sys.path.insert calls from the test suite

TQ003 stands at 1,077 across 1,058 files, and 1,015 of them are the same shape:
sys.path.insert(0, os.path.abspath("../..")) and its deeper siblings. The
argument resolves against the working directory rather than the file, so from
the repo root, where every job runs pytest, it inserts the directory two levels
above the checkout. It has never pointed at litellm. The package is installed
into the environment anyway, which is what actually makes the import work, and
what the rule's message has said all along.

Removing them leaves 1,634 imports of sys and os with no remaining reference,
and those go too, except where another test module imports the name back out of
the file. The rest of TQ003 is 62 call sites that resolve against __file__ or a
variable, which are a different question and are left alone.

Collection is identical either way: 45,871 tests and the same 51 pre-existing
collection errors before and after, and ruff reports no new undefined name.

"""
Tests for Bedrock Moonshot (Kimi K2) integration.
This test suite verifies:
1. Basic completion functionality
2. Streaming responses
3. System message support
4. Temperature parameter handling
5. Reasoning content extraction from <reasoning> tags
6. Tool calling support (including tool response handling)
7. Parameter validation (e.g., stop sequences not supported)
"""
from base_llm_unit_tests import BaseLLMChatTest
import httpx
import pytest
import os
import json
from typing import Optional
from unittest.mock import AsyncMock, Mock, patch
import litellm
from litellm.llms.bedrock.common_utils import get_bedrock_chat_config
from litellm.llms.custom_httpx.http_handler import AsyncHTTPHandler, HTTPHandler
class TestBedrockMoonshotInvoke(BaseLLMChatTest):
"""
Test suite for Bedrock Moonshot via invoke route.
Inherits all standard LLM tests from BaseLLMChatTest.
"""
def get_base_completion_call_args(self) -> dict:
litellm._turn_on_debug()
return {
"model": "bedrock/invoke/moonshot.kimi-k2-thinking",
}
def test_tool_call_no_arguments(self, tool_call_no_arguments):
"""Test that tool calls with no arguments is translated correctly."""
pass
# ---------------------------------------------------------------------
# The overrides below replace inherited BaseLLMChatTest tests that would
# otherwise make live AWS Bedrock calls. The live versions were
# consistently crashing llm_translation xdist workers. Each override
# patches the HTTP client's post() so no network request is sent, and
# asserts on the outgoing request body (and, where needed, parses a
# canned response) — which is what the translation lane is actually
# supposed to cover.
# ---------------------------------------------------------------------
